R (Clue) v Birmingham (2010)
A local authority had been wrong to deny assistance to a family awaiting a decision on their application for indefinite leave to remain in the UK. Consideration should have been paid to their welfare whilst their application was in process.
[2010] EWCA Civ 460 29/4/2010. Reported at Times, 7 May 2010

R (Boyejo) v Barnet London Borough Council; R (Smith) v Portsmouth City Council (2009)
Local authority decisions to withdraw residential warden services were unlawful in breach of the Disability Discrimination Act 1995.
[2009] EWHC 3261 Admin 15/12/2009. Reported at Times, January 22, 2010

R (Garbet) v Circle 33 Housing Trust (2009)
A housing association's decision to withdraw residential warden services was unlawful because there had been a contractual obligation to provide those services and because those services had been withdrawn without prior consultation.
[2009] EWHC 3153 Admin 7/12/2009

R(H) & others v Wandsworth, Lambeth and Islington London Borough Council (2007)
Homeless children in need must be accommodated under Children Act 1989, s 20 and not s 17. This case brings to an end the practice of many local authorities of accommodating child asylum-seekers, and others, under s 17, when those children meet the s.20 criteria.
[2007] EWHC 1082 Admin 23/4/2007. Reported at [2007] 2 FLR 2 822.

Birmingham City Council v Ali and others (2009)
Women who are occupying rooms in women's refuges, having fled domestic violence, do not have any accommodation which it is reasonable to continue to occupy. As a result, they are "homeless" within the statutory definition of homelessness and entitled to the benefit of homelessness assistance from local housing authorities under Part 7 Housing Act 1996.
[2009] UKHL 36 1/7/2009. Reported at (2009) 1 WLR 1506.
